Carrie F Sprinkle (Postmaster)
120 Turkey Mountain Rd
Clifford, VA 24533
Clifford, VA 24533
The Clifford Post Office is located in the state of Virginia within Amherst County. This location serves 0 Clifford residents with a median income of $0. It's estimated that approximately 0 packages pass through this post office each year.